President authenticates Appropriation Bill (Budget)



KATHMANDU: President Bidya Devi Bhandari has authenticated the Appropriation Bill (Budget) 2021 Thursday.

According to the President’s Office, the bill was certified by President Bhandari Thursday after it was passed by both the Houses of Parliament.

With this, the government can now spend state funds and the budget holiday ended. The government had been without a budget and went into budget holiday after the budget ordinance could not be passed by September 15, as required.

The Deuba government had brought a replacement bill to replace the budget brought by the then Oli government through an ordinance. After the replacement bill took time to be passed, the government was without budget.

Although the Approtiation (budget) Bill has been ratified, two more bills related to the budget were passed by the House of Representatives only on Thursday. Now the National Assembly is likely to pass both the bills on Friday.
